Hi all, I have a 2005 Sportser xl custom which has had stage 1 tuning done. I find that if I rev hard to overtake in 1st/2nd gear it gets to a point where it feels like a limiter cutting in. Im not sure if it is or whether its a carburettor problem. Anybody else had a similar problem? Thanks.

I ride a 2009 XL883L with VH Short Shots, VH Duke intake, and X14iED. I have never had a stage 1 download. About a week ago, I was jumping into traffic and hit the rev limiter at 40mph in first gear. My 883 didn't feel like it was falling on its face or anything like that, it just said, "upshit dumba$$"

I know you have a carb and I have EFI, but if you were going anything near 40 in 1st, then maybe that is what you felt.
